FBS-CFB Game Preview: #20 Mississippi Rebels (1-0) vs. Kentucky Wildcats (1-0)

0
69

Venue & Kickoff

Location: Kroger Field, Lexington, Kentucky

Date: Saturday, September 6, 2025

Time: 3:30 PM ET / 2:30 PM CT

Broadcast: ABC (Sean McDonough, Greg McElroy, Molly McGrath)

Capacity: 61,000

Weather Forecast

Conditions: Partly cloudy

Temperature: ~82°F at kickoff

Wind: Light, 5–7 mph

Precipitation: ~25% chance in the morning, trending dry by kickoff

Impact: Minimal — warm, slightly humid conditions; no major weather disruptions expected

Injury Report

Ole Miss Rebels

Out: WR Caleb Cunningham, WR Traylon Ray, TE Luke Hasz

Doubtful: OL Terez Davis, WR Samari Reed

Questionable: CB Jaylon Braxton, TE Dae’Quan Wright, CB Ricky Fletcher, CB Dante Core, OL Delano Townsend

Kentucky Wildcats

Out: DL Nic Smith, WR David Washington Jr., WR Preston Bowman

Doubtful: WR DJ Miller

Questionable: RB Jamarion Wilcox, OL Aba Selm

Probable: DB DJ Waller Jr., DL M. Humphrey-Grace

Recent Form

Ole Miss: 695 yards of offense in opener; 15 players made first start for program

Kentucky: Defense held Toledo to 59 rush yards; offense leaned heavily on ground game

Key Player Matchups

QB Austin Simmons (OM) vs. QB Zach Calzada (UK)

Simmons: 20/31, 341 yds, 3 TD, 2 INT in debut

Calzada: 10/23, 85 yds, 0 TD, 1 INT; 1 rush TD

RB Kewan Lacy / Logan Diggs (OM) vs. RB Dante Dowdell / Seth McGowan (UK)

Lacy: 108 yds, 3 TD; Diggs: 91 yds, 1 TD

Dowdell: 129 yds, 1 TD; McGowan: 78 yds, 1 TD

WR Harrison Wallace III (OM) vs. CB Maxwell Hairston (UK)

Wallace: 5 rec, 130 yds, 1 TD

Hairston: All-SEC caliber cover corner

DL Zxavian Harris (OM) vs. UK Offensive Line

Harris: 5 tackles, 1 sack, 1 INT, 2 QB hurries vs. GSU

Series History

All-Time: Ole Miss leads 30–15–1

Last Meeting: Kentucky 20–17 (2024, Oxford)

Recent Trend: Last 4 meetings decided by one score; UK has covered in last two

Betting Trends

Ole Miss: 1–0 ATS in 2025; 6–4 ATS as ≥9.5-point favorite since 2023

Kentucky: 0–1 ATS in 2025; 4–0 ATS as ≥9.5-point underdog since 2023

UNDER has hit in last 2 meetings

Last 4 matchups decided by ≤7 points
